What are some common challenges faced by an associate defense attorney during their initial years, and how can they be addressed?

Associate Defense Attorneys often encounter challenges such as managing a high caseload, learning to navigate court procedures, and balancing client expectations with legal realities. In the early years, it can be difficult to build confidence in the courtroom and develop effective negotiation skills. These challenges are best addressed by seeking mentorship from senior attorneys, actively participating in case strategy discussions, and dedicating time to stay updated on legal precedents and local court rules. Strong organizational skills and open communication with team members also help in managing workload and client relationships effectively.

What is an associate defense attorney?

Associate Defense Attorneys are licensed lawyers who work under the supervision of more senior attorneys within a law firm or public defender's office. They focus on defending clients accused of crimes by conducting legal research, drafting motions, attending court hearings, and assisting in trial preparation. Associates are typically early in their legal careers and gain practical experience by working closely with experienced defense attorneys on a variety of criminal cases.

What is the difference between Associate Defense Attorney vs Public Defender?

AspectAssociate Defense AttorneyPublic Defender
CredentialsJuris Doctor (JD), license to practice lawJuris Doctor (JD), license to practice law
Work EnvironmentPrivate law firms, corporate legal departments, government agenciesPublic defender offices, government-funded legal services
Employer & IndustryLaw firms, government agencies, corporationsGovernment-funded public defense offices
Common Search/ComparisonAssociate Defense Attorney vs Public Defender

Both Associate Defense Attorneys and Public Defenders hold a Juris Doctor degree and are licensed to practice law. While Associate Defense Attorneys often work in private firms or corporate settings, Public Defenders are employed by government agencies to provide legal defense for indigent clients. The primary difference lies in their employment environment and client base, with Public Defenders focusing on public service and indigent defense, whereas Associate Defense Attorneys may handle a broader range of clients in various legal settings.
